数电课程设计四路抢答器.docx
- 文档编号:9707790
- 上传时间:2023-02-05
- 格式:DOCX
- 页数:11
- 大小:634.37KB
数电课程设计四路抢答器.docx
《数电课程设计四路抢答器.docx》由会员分享,可在线阅读,更多相关《数电课程设计四路抢答器.docx(11页珍藏版)》请在冰豆网上搜索。
数电课程设计四路抢答器
课程设计说明书
(小初号字距4磅黑体加黑居中)
课程名称:
数字电子技术课程设计
题目:
四路抢答器
学生姓名:
李时川
专业:
电子信息科学与技术
班级:
11-2
学号:
18
指导教师:
杨艳
日期:
2013年3月29日
四路抢答器
一、设计任务与要求
设计一个四组参赛的智力竞赛抢答器
基本要求:
(1)当某台参赛者按下抢答开关时,由数码管显示该台编号并伴有声响。
此时,抢答器不再接收其他输入信号。
(2)电路具有定时功能。
要求回答问题的时间≤30秒(显示为29~00),时间显示采用倒计时方式。
当达到限定时间时,发出声响提示。
(3)具有计分功能。
每组参赛者起始分为100分,抢答后由主持人计分,答对1次加10分,否则减去10分
(4)在复位状态下台号数码管不作任何显示(灭灯)。
提高要求:
(5)答题时间还剩5s时,每秒发出提示声音。
二、方案设计与论证
抢答器的基本工作原理:
1.当主持人按下“开关”按钮后,选手可以通过按按钮的快慢来决定由谁来回答,按得快的选手的编号显示在电子显示管上并该选手桌上的发光二极管亮灯。
2.此后选手输入被锁住,如果主持人按下复位键则编号显示处不作任何显示。
3.然后主持人就按下计时开关,选手开始作答,作答的时间少于30秒,以倒数的方式进行,而且通过显示屏把时间显示出来。
4.当选手作答仅剩5秒时,开始通过喇叭响来做提示。
如果到了显示“00”时,计时器不再进行倒数而停留在“00”状态。
5.此时选手仍没有作答成功,则主持人会对该选手进行减分处理,如果在“00”之前作答成功则加分,分数也是通过计分器显示出来。
每位选手初始分数为100分,加减分每次10分。
6.之后主持人按下开关,所有的显示及工作状态回到初始状态以便进行下一次答题。
原理框架图
台号显示
方案一、对照上面原理框架图,各个主要的部分选用对应功能的芯片进行设计。
方案二、对照框架图,选用各种逻辑站以及相关的逻辑函数进行设计,编号进直接把锁存器的输出转化8421BCD码,并通过逻辑函数表达式的方式输入到显示译码器中让其显示出来。
通过比较可以得出方案一更可行,理由在于芯片组上集成的功能要强大些,且用的元器件的数目会相对少一些这样会更美观而且不容易出错。
三、单元电路设计与参数计算
Ⅰ、抢答电路
设计思路
1.开关模拟抢答按钮,开关闭合表示抢答,断开表示不抢答,每次抢答完必须断开,为了防止有人在第一次抢答的过程中忘记将开关断开,导致第二次当主持人复位的瞬间将抢答成功,特别在开关与触发器之间并联蜂鸣器,当开关没有断开蜂鸣器便一直会响;
2.两个双D触发器,当有人按下抢答按钮之后,其他人无法抢答
3.发光二极管阴极分别接触发器的Q非端,阳极接VCC。
4.显示编号的电路
当有选手按下了开关后,快的那个选手的编号可以被输出并记忆起来送到74148和数码管组成的显示台号电路中去显示出选手编号。
Ⅱ、30秒倒计时电路
1.两个模十计数器组成30进制减法计数器
在比赛规则里,要求选手的答题时间不能超到30秒,因此必须要有一个定时电路,这个电路可以设计成30进制加法器,但是更多的情况下,为了直观的原因我们采用的是30进制减法计数器。
如果选手能在30秒里答对,则算答题成功,否则为失败。
而且在最后的5秒钟伴有响声做为提示,当时最后到达00时,响声也会停止。
为了实现30进制减法计数器,采用了74192芯片,它具有加减法功能,是同步10进制的。
74LS192(54/74194)两个引脚图管脚及功能表如下:
74LS192是同步十进制可逆计数器,它具有双时钟输入,并具有清除和置数等功能,其引脚排列及逻辑符号如下所示:
(a)引脚排列 (b)逻辑符号
图中:
为置数端,
为加计数端,
为减计数端,
为非同步进位输出端,
为非同步借位输出端,P0、P1、P2、P3为计数器输入端,
为清除端,Q0、Q1、Q2、Q3为数据输出端。
其功能表如下:
输入
输出
MR
P3
P2
P1
P0
Q3
Q2
Q1
Q0
1
×
×
×
×
×
×
×
0
0
0
0
0
0
×
×
d
c
b
a
d
c
b
a
0
1
1
×
×
×
×
加计数
0
1
1
×
×
×
×
减计数
定时器电路如上
上图用两块74192来组成30进制减法计数器,通过置数法让一有电源输入到该电路上,就直接把输出置为30,差通过数码管显示出来.
2.用数值比较器74LS85检测第五秒(0000,0101),输出Y=B端接触发器,当第五秒到来时送出高电平使D触发器驱动蜂鸣器工作.
3.门电路组成检零电路,当倒计时结束时使整个倒计时电路停止工作,即使蜂鸣器和数码管停止工作
Ⅲ、记分电路
1.当选手作答完后,要根据选手答题的情况来进行加法或减分。
而这个加分减分功能我同样用了74192,每答对一题得10分,答错一题减10分,主持人根据选手答题情况来加减分,每位选手初始分数为100分。
这个电路是通过一个BUTTON按钮,按一下会自动的弹上来,这样确保每一次的按和放都有一次的脉冲输入,两个开关A.B分别代表加分减分,将开关的一端接脉冲,另一端接UP或DOWN,然后能过输出就可以知道当前得分
四、总电路工作原理及元器件清单
由于电路过大,所以将电路分成3部分显示
Ⅰ、抢答电路
Ⅱ、30秒倒计时电路
当主持人按下答题开始按钮,倒计时电路开始工作,到第五秒至零秒的时候会伴有蜂鸣器提醒声音,记时结束后蜂鸣器和数码管都停止工作;
Ⅲ、记分电路
2.总电路工作原理
当主持人按下“开关”按钮后,选手可以通过按按钮的快慢来决定由谁来回答,按得快的选手的编号显示在电子显示管上并伴有响声。
此后选手输入锁住,如果主持人按下复位键则编号显示处不作任何显示。
然后主持人就按计时开关,选手开始作答,作答的时间少于30秒,以倒数的方式进行,而通过显示屏把时间显示出来。
当选手作答仅剩5秒时,开始通过喇叭响来做提示。
此时选手仍没有作答成功,则主持人会对该选手进行减分处理,如果在“00”之前作答成功则加分,分数也是通过计分器显示出来。
之后主持人按下开关,所有的显示及工作状态回到初始状态以便进行下一次答题。
3.元件清单
元件序号
型号
主要参数
数量
备注
U
74LS74
3
触发器
U
74LS148
1
编码器
U
74LS85
2
数值比较器
U
74LS192
4
计数器
U
DCD_HEX
5
数码管
U
BUZZER
5
蜂鸣器
LED
LED
4
发光二极管
U
74LS系列
门
五、仿真调试与分析
本次设计的仿真我采用了Multisim仿真软件做,主要是感觉本软件用起来感觉比较简单,打开仿真开关,拨动复位按钮,模拟进行抢答,当第一个抢答按钮按下之后其他抢答开关无效,并且伴有发光二极管发光,数码管显示相对应台号。
当此人抢答成功后,30秒倒计时电路开始工作,当倒计时到5秒时数值比较器74LS85送出高电平使D触发器驱动蜂鸣器工作.在这里我一直遇到一个问题,就是发现当计时为00时,蜂鸣器在此后一直在响,所以添加了检零电路,当倒计时结束时使整个倒计时电路停止工作。
之后就是记分电路,主持人对选手的答题结果进行加分或减分情况。
六、结论与心得
本次课题感觉上还是比较难的,虽然做起来前面比较顺,但坐到后面发现问题很多,修改起来有一定难度,就比如说上文提到的5秒倒计时蜂鸣器问题,而且刚开始做仿真时还忘了用数码管显示选手编号,很是纠结。
总体来说,感觉做的还是不错吧,通过本次设计,主要对对常用的芯片无论是从功能上,还是构造上都在了更深的了解,更重要的是锻炼了我们的动手能力,平时看书都能看得明白,但是到了仿真的时候还是会出现很多的问题,有时候一个小失误致使整个电路工作状态出现错误,但是还是能过一次次的调试,一次次地去修改最后得出了成品。
也学了一个新的软件,这也是很重要的。
反正这次课程设计收获也不少,但是如果时间能够再充分一点,我相信自己能够做得更好。
七、参考文献
[1]彭介华.电子技术课程设计指导[M].北京:
高等教育出版社
[2]孙梅生,李美莺,徐振英.电子技术基础课程设计[M].北京:
高等教育出版社
[3]梁宗善.电子技术基础课程设计[M].武汉:
华中理工大学出版社
[4]张玉璞,李庆常.电子技术课程设计[M].北京:
北京理工大学出版社
[5]谢自美.电子线路设计•实验•测试(第二版)[M].武汉:
华中科技大学出版社
[6]《数字电子技术基本教程》阎石清华大学出版社
[7]《电路与电子技术实验》电工电子实验中心
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 课程设计 四路 抢答